hey all

ive had my dstt for about a year now and i have recently got a Rom for pokemon heart gold
now ive played it for a bit completed it and now im wanting to use some cheats.
So ive dled the latest "Usercheat.dat" file and ive put it on my SD but when i turned on my ds there was no cheats for the game.
Then i dled a program called "Cheat Code Editor" i used to use this program when i was cheating a year ago.And now since our computer got wiped i had to Dl a newer version . Anyways when i open the USERCHEAT.DAT file on the program it crashes and goes unreponsive, is this a common problem??? Ive just updated the kernel on the dstt, but i doubt it would do anything since my problem is computer based.
Any ideas on how to fix this? maybe i could get a link for a older version of cheat code editor? or maybe there is another way to add cheats to the USERCHEAT file (manually).
